A taxon that does not include the last common ancestor of all its members is a _____ group.

A monophyletic taxon is also called a clade. Paraphyletic taxon : A group composed of a collection of organisms, including the most recent common ancestor of all those organisms. Unlike a monophyletic group, a paraphyletic taxon does not include all the descendants of the most recent common ancestor.
